Has anyone else experienced these strange bugs? They're all of them intermittent and I can't reproduce them 100% of the time, but ever since 1.2.1 I've been having some strange issues:
- When sitting on the Touchstone charger, but the screen is active (on), and I have my notifications maximized, the notifications will... time out? The error message that you get when too many cards are open will flash up on the screen for just a moment while the notifications minimize. Then the error message goes away. It happens all within about 1 or 2 seconds. - My Pre has told me 4 times now that there's an update available for my phone. I let it take me to the update screen, and it's already downloaded 1.2.1 for me to install. I go ahead and let it run the install and it boots up fine. Then a few days later, it does it all over again. - Screen auto-adjusts brightness even though the setting is turned off. There are some other strange bugs that I've been having too, but they happen so infrequently I can't remember what they are. I don't have any tweaks turned on, my phone isn't in developer mode, I do have a couple homebrew apps on my Pre, but they've all been out for a while and are at their most recent versions. I'm just wondering if anyone else has noticed their Pre acting buggy since the 1.2.1 rollout. |
